IMI Industrial Services Group has been self-performing specialty contracting work since 1988, serving Fortune 500 companies across industrial and commercial markets from its Watkinsville, GA campus near Athens. For facility managers overseeing large-footprint commercial properties, IMI's single-source model is its most operationally relevant differentiator: one dedicated project manager coordinates all trades, controls costs, and enforces schedules — eliminating the coordination gaps that typically cause roofing projects on industrial and warehouse facilities to run over budget or behind schedule. IMI's specialty coating division positions the company squarely in the commercial roofing space, with particular applicability to metal roofing systems, SPF coatings, and protective membrane applications common on industrial manufacturing plants, warehouse distribution centers, and institutional buildings throughout the Athens, GA region. Facility managers managing aging metal standing-seam roofs or built-up roofing systems on large-footprint properties will find IMI's in-house fabrication and structural capabilities especially useful — the company can address roof deck issues, structural supports, and penetration flashing as part of a single integrated scope rather than subcontracting those trades out. IMI's engineering team and on-site machine shop allow for custom fabrication of flashings, curbs, and equipment supports that standard roofing contractors typically cannot self-perform. This is particularly valuable on industrial and healthcare facilities where mechanical equipment penetrations and roof-mounted systems are dense. For property managers or general contractors overseeing complex commercial re-roofing or coating restoration projects in the Athens metro, IMI's integrated approach reduces risk and administrative burden. The company's deep experience in piping, structural fabrication, and facilities maintenance means roofing scopes can be bundled with related building envelope and mechanical work — a meaningful efficiency on large commercial campuses.
